AV Announces AV_Halo Unified Software Platform for Next-Gen Operational Advantage

AeroVironment, Inc. (“AV”) (NASDAQ: AVAV), a global defense technology leader delivering software-enabled disruptive autonomous systems, today announced AV_Halo™, a hardware-agnostic software platform that unifies the company's suite of mission-ready software tools — to include multi-domain command and control (C2), AI-enhanced intelligence analysis, synthetic training, and autonomous targeting — into a single open-standards software ecosystem capable of integrating with any other battle management systems. AV_Halo provides a modular, mission-ready suite of AI-powered software tools that empowers warfighters to dominate the mission–across air, land, sea, space and cyber domains.

"In today’s rapidly evolving operational environment, speed, autonomy, modularity, and interoperability are non-negotiable," said Wahid Nawabi, AV Chairman, President, and Chief Executive Officer. "With edge intelligence, mission autonomy and dynamic C2, we will build upon our unique ability to carry out maneuver warfare in the age of drones dominance. AV_Halo is designed for the battlefield of tomorrow–empowering warfighters to seamlessly command diverse crewed and uncrewed assets across domains and make better decisions faster to reduce risk to human life."

AV’s integrated software stack, matched with the company's autonomous systems and precision munitions, enables full battlefield dominance: detect, decide, deliver. The initial roll-out of the company's AV_Halo software strategy will focus on three mission-critical capability sets:

  • AV_Halo COMMAND: Battle Management with C2 for Unmanned Vehicles – Situational awareness drives decision-making with continuous, AI-enhanced sensor feeds, telemetry, and environmental data into a secure, mission-specific operating picture. It enables theater-wide asset coordination, whether fixed, mobile, or distributed. AV_Halo COMMAND fuses AV’s KINESISTM tactical universal control architecture with VigilantHalo mission control User Interface and robust sensor fusion engine to provide a layered C2 capability for both offensive and defensive missions.  AV_Halo COMMAND integrates with other services within the software platform as well as other third-party capabilities.
  • AV_Halo VISION: Onboard Computer Vision for Autonomous Targeting – AV_Halo VISION enables real-time visual processing and Intelligence, Surveillance and Reconnaissance (ISR) capabilities on-platform, even in GPS-denied or comms-degraded environments. Enhanced with fused tracking from AV_Halo COMMAND’s C2 core, it delivers persistent autonomous targeting. AV_Halo VISION includes AV’s SPOTR Edge computer vision software and WISARD AI/ML processing module.
  • AV_Halo PINPOINT: Directed Energy, Pointing and Tracking Technologies – Exact target acquisition and tracking for offensive radio frequency (RF) and laser capability payloads allows new and legacy platforms to operate independently across ISR, loitering, and strike profiles. Used in combination with AV_Halo COMMAND enables responsive autonomy driven by real-time threat perception. AV_Halo PINPOINT is at the core of AV’s LOCUST Laser Weapon SystemTM and Titan C-UASTM family of products.

“AV_Halo leverages the large portfolio of AV’s software suite of applications in one common software core, integrating our rapid product development process to accelerate innovation, interoperability, and deployment,” said Scott Bowman, AV Chief Technology Officer & Vice President of Global Engineering. “For mission planning or mission command, for mounted or dismounted operations, for training or for frontlines, AV_Halo wraps around all platforms and provides the flexibility and speed necessary to meet the challenges of tomorrow, today.”

AV_Halo follows the principles of the Modular Open Systems Approach (MOSA), a design strategy mandated by the U.S. Department of Defense (DoD) to improve interoperability, agility, and sustainability in defense systems. As missions evolve, AV_Halo scales effortlessly, offering reliable solutions that adapt to emerging threats and operational demands–enabling operators to deploy exactly what is needed for any mission while minimizing cost. It seamlessly integrates across allied military and commercial systems, setting a new standard for interoperability in complex, multi-domain environments.
